Your role as Project Manager
As a Project Manager at Global Rail Group, you will play a pivotal role in support of delivering technical and operational projects across North America. This role is well suited for an independent, motivated professional who enjoys responsibility, thrives in a dynamic environment, and values close interaction with customers and senior management.
You will manage projects, act as a customer-facing representative, and contribute to the continuous improvement of our project delivery practices within a flat organizational structure.
- Support manage and deliver operational, technical, and engineering-related projects across the North American continent Execute in the planning, coordinate, and monitor project scope, timelines, resources, risks, and deliverables
- Act as the primary point of contact for customers, ensuring close collaboration and high service quality
- Coordinate with internal stakeholders across engineering, operations, and management functions
- Support project budget compliance, cost tracking, and financial reporting in line with agreed targets
- Be a key support for identifying risks and issues early, proactively address these to your direct line of report to Head of North American Operational Project Management to discuss mitigation strategies, and escalate when required
- Ensure that project staff have all requisite safety training
- Ensure project documentation, reporting, and governance standards are maintained
- Support to translate technical and engineering concepts into clear, actionable information for customers and internal teams
- Contribute to process improvements and best practices in project and operational management
- Operate effectively in a flat hierarchy with direct access to senior management and decision-makers
- Ensure contract deliverables are executed, delivered on time, and appropriately invoiced
